* {
	margin: 0;
	padding: 0;
	border: 0;
}

a.Barlink:link
{
	 COLOR: #ffffff;
	 TEXT-DECORATION: none
}
a.Barlink:visited {
	 COLOR: #ffffff;
	 TEXT-DECORATION: none
}
a.Barlink:hover {
	 COLOR: #ffffff;
	 TEXT-DECORATION: underline
}

body {
	width: 550px;
	margin: auto;
	font-family: verdana;
	font-size: 10pt;
}

h1 {
	text-align: center;
	margin: 1em;
}

hr {
	width: 60%;
	border: #000 solid 1px;
	border-top: #000 solid 2px;
	margin: 1em auto 2em;
}

img {
	vertical-align: middle;
	display: block;
	margin: auto;
}

blockquote {
	text-align: justify;
}

.auteur {
	text-align: right;
	padding: 0.5em;
}

table {
	width: 100%;
	margin: 1em 0;
	text-align: center;
}

tr {
	border-bottom: #000 solid 1px;
}
td {
	padding: 0.3em;
}

td.nom {
	width: 45%;
}
td.grade {
	width: 10%;
}
td.date {
	width: 45%;
}